https://bugs.winehq.org/show_bug.cgi?id=44540
Bug ID: 44540 Summary: Imperium GBR terminate unexpectly when using native quartz.dll Product: Wine Version: 3.2 Hardware: x86-64 OS: Linux Status: UNCONFIRMED Severity: normal Priority: P2 Component: quartz Assignee: wine-bugs@winehq.org Reporter: lorenzofer@live.it Distribution: ---
Created attachment 60497 --> https://bugs.winehq.org/attachment.cgi?id=60497 log with dsound setted as native
Imperium GBR terminate unexpectly (without crash), with exit code -127 when using native quartz.dll (from directmusic winetricks component)
The beheviour change if I have dsound setted as builtin or native. If dsound is setted as builtin the game exit after the resolution change, before playing the videos.
If dsound is setted as native the game play the videos and then terminate before entering the main menu.
For playing music in the game it need dsound,dmime,dmsynth,dmusic,dswave as native (this issue happens in the described ways if the mentioned dll (other then dsound) are setted as builtin or native)
https://bugs.winehq.org/show_bug.cgi?id=44540
--- Comment #1 from Lorenzo Ferrillo lorenzofer@live.it --- Created attachment 60498 --> https://bugs.winehq.org/attachment.cgi?id=60498 Log with dsound setted as builtin
https://bugs.winehq.org/show_bug.cgi?id=44540
Lorenzo Ferrillo lorenzofer@live.it changed:
What |Removed |Added ---------------------------------------------------------------------------- Distribution|--- |ArchLinux CC| |aeikum@codeweavers.com
https://bugs.winehq.org/show_bug.cgi?id=44540
--- Comment #2 from Lorenzo Ferrillo lorenzofer@live.it --- Andrew sorry to bother you.
I putted you into the CC list becouse you were very active on others dsound related bugs, and may give some insight of what is going terribily wrong here
https://bugs.winehq.org/show_bug.cgi?id=44540
Lorenzo Ferrillo lorenzofer@live.it chang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|UNCONFIRMED |RESOLVED Component|quartz |winex11.drv Resolution|--- |FIXED Fixed by SHA1| |22993aff94ad4b3539ed99648f8 | |180cfc7b9253c
--- Comment #3 from Lorenzo Ferrillo lorenzofer@live.it --- Hi Everyone.
It seems this bug is FIXED in 4.17, specifically in the 22993aff94ad4b3539ed99648f8180cfc7b9253c commit: winex11: Track the client colormap separately.
Marking the bug as fixed, and recategorizing the bug to component x11drv as it should be.
Note: At the first 2019 release winetricks replaced the quartz.dll file with another one. I could not test for this bug the new file, as there is another bug blocking (still unreported as I want to investigate it a bit more, as it seem not properly reprodcible). This bug affect the quartz.dll from the DirectX9 (Feb 2010), using winetricks 20181203
https://bugs.winehq.org/show_bug.cgi?id=44540
Lorenzo Ferrillo lorenzofer@live.it changed:
What |Removed |Added ---------------------------------------------------------------------------- Summary|Imperium GBR terminate |Imperium GBR close |unexpectly when using |unexpectly with native |native quartz.dll |quartz.dll (DirectX9 Feb | |2010 redist) and dsound.dll
--- Comment #4 from Lorenzo Ferrillo lorenzofer@live.it --- EDit: The resolved bug is the X11 crash with quartz.dll and dsound.dll setted as native.
When quartz.dll is native and dsound.dll is builtin the game still terminate, but without involving X11 errors, so it seems it is actually something else causing this.
I will keep this bug as resolved to indicate the first bug (X11 abort when dsound and quartz are native).
https://bugs.winehq.org/show_bug.cgi?id=44540
--- Comment #5 from Lorenzo Ferrillo lorenzofer@live.it --- EDit: The resolved bug is the X11 crash with quartz.dll and dsound.dll setted as native.
When quartz.dll is native and dsound.dll is builtin the game still terminate, but without involving X11 errors, so it seems it is actually something else causing this.
I will keep this bug as resolved to indicate the first bug (X11 abort when dsound and quartz are native).
https://bugs.winehq.org/show_bug.cgi?id=44540
Alexandre Julliard julliard@winehq.org changed:
What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ED
--- Comment #6 from Alexandre Julliard julliard@winehq.org --- Closing bugs fixed in 4.18.